The Republic of Karelia and the Chukotka have higher drug use rates than other regions of similar populations. This could indicate that there are specific regional influences on drug use.
For example, recent investigations have found that the synthetic psychedelic drug 2C-B has become more prevalent in rural areas of Scotland due to its availability on the dark web. Similarly, methamphetamine use has surged in rural American areas, with rates now surpassing those in urban areas, likely due in part to easier access through online platforms. Aggressive online marketing by sellers also boosts awareness of, and accessibility to, drugs in areas where exposure to them is limited offline or among consumers who may not have encountered these substances through traditional channels.

The majority of the internet (an estimated 95 percent) exists within the deep web, unindexed by search engines like Google and Bing. The dark web lives within the deep web, and it requires specific software, configurations and authorization to access. Of the 19 cocaine samples tested, only four were pure cocaine, while 13 contained other substances and two samples did not contain any cocaine at all. Mercifully, the escrow system now largely keeps dealers from pulling these sorts of tricks (they don’t get paid until the product arrives, after all). Buying directly from an online dealer—as opposed to through one of the marketplaces—is generally inadvisable. There’s no escrow system when you do that and, therefore, no guarantee they’ll actually send you something.

As large platforms face disruption from law enforcement action, dark web infighting, and an influx of users from Telegram, there’s a growing shift toward smaller, more specialized marketplaces. These new niche sites are focused on specific illicit goods, offering enhanced security and a more targeted environment for buyers and sellers. The shift to digital trade was accelerated by the COVID-19 pandemic, as lockdowns pushed many consumers and vendors towards online platforms. As these transactions are more insular and anonymous than in-person trade, it is more difficult to track user behaviour. However, new local patterns have emerged, along with unique risks that are less common in offline markets, such as exposure to cyber fraud or health concerns caused by the use of unregulated substances by unpractised users. Despite these risks, digital drug markets are often seen as a safer alternative to street dealing, attracting new users who might have avoided traditional markets due to fear of violence or law enforcement. The shift to digital markets has also reshaped the way illicit substances are bought, sold and distributed.

This shift poses unique challenges for law enforcement, who must adapt traditional monitoring methods. The fragmentation of darknet markets means that law enforcement agencies can no longer focus their efforts on a few large, easily identifiable targets. Instead, they must gain access to multiple, hyper-secure markets and then regularly monitor this wide array of smaller, highly localized platforms. Further confounding efforts, these multiple markets are often scattered across different regions and jurisdictions, requiring significant international cooperation to drive operations. In 2025, agencies will need to deploy a combination of advanced cyber tools, including AI-driven pattern recognition, blockchain analysis, and network infiltration strategies, to track illicit activity across multiple channels.
